A quick photostory from an 8 Day trip from Germany to Estonia

In preparation for my summer Trans-Russia trip I rode the bike (clapped out nasty looking '87 Transalp) from my folk's house in western Germany to Tallinn in Estonia, riding through Poland, Lithuania and Latvia to Estonia. The sun shone most of the way.
